What it means
F01690 is reported by the Control Unit (CU) when there is not sufficient memory space in the NVRAM on the drive to save the parameters r9781 and r9782 — the safety logbook of SI Motion. NVRAM stands for Non-Volatile Random Access Memory (non-volatile read and write memory). The drive does not respond to this fault with an automatic stop, and the fault does not result in a safety stop response. Which of the two underlying situations applies is shown by the fault value in r0949.
Why it appears
- The NVRAM on the drive does not have sufficient memory space to save the parameters r9781 and r9782 (the safety logbook).
- There is no physical NVRAM available in the drive at all, so the safety logbook data cannot be stored (this corresponds to fault value 0).
What to check
- Read the fault value in r0949 and interpret it as a decimal number; it tells you which of the two situations the drive has detected.
- Fault value 0: use a Control Unit NVRAM.
- Fault value 1: deselect functions that are not required and that take up memory space in the NVRAM.
- Fault value 1: if the memory space cannot be freed this way, contact Technical Support.
Reading the message value
- The drive writes the fault value into r0949; interpret the value as a decimal number.
- 0 — there is no physical NVRAM available in the drive.
- 1 — there is no longer any free memory space in the NVRAM.
Parameters the manual names
- r0949 — read out here which case applies: fault value 0 (no physical NVRAM in the drive) or fault value 1 (no free memory space left); interpret the value as a decimal number.
- r9781 — SI checksum to check changes (Control Unit): one of the two safety logbook parameters the drive could not save in the NVRAM.
- r9782 — SI time stamps to check changes (Control Unit): the second safety logbook parameter the drive could not save in the NVRAM.
Acknowledging and restarting
The drive only removes this fault when its power supply has been switched off and on again (POWER ON acknowledgement); it cannot be cleared while the drive is running. The fault itself does not result in a safety stop response.
What differs between the drive families
Straight from the manuals' own fields — F01690 is not described identically everywhere.
| Drive family | Reaction | Acknowledge | Message class | Component | Manual |
|---|---|---|---|---|---|
| S120, S150 | Infeed: NONE (OFF1, OFF2) Servo: NONE (OFF1, OFF2, OFF3) Vector: NONE (OFF1, OFF2, OFF3) Hla: NONE (OFF1, OFF2, OFF3) | POWER ON | Hardware/software error (1) | Control Unit (CU) | SINAMICS S120, S150 List Manual · p. 2669 |
| G130, G150 | Vector: NONE (OFF1, OFF2, OFF3) Infeed: NONE (OFF1, OFF2) | POWER ON | Hardware/software error (1) | Control Unit (CU) | SINAMICS G130, G150 List Manual · p. 1458 |
| G120 | NONE (OFF1, OFF2, OFF3) | POWER ON | Hardware/software error (1) | — | SINAMICS G120 · p. 849 |

Questions technicians ask
What does fault F01690 on a SINAMICS drive mean?
The Control Unit could not save the SI Motion safety logbook — parameters r9781 and r9782 — because there is not sufficient memory space in the NVRAM, or no physical NVRAM is available in the drive.
How do I fix F01690?
Read the fault value in r0949, interpreted as a decimal number. If it is 0, use a Control Unit NVRAM; if it is 1, deselect functions that are not required and that take up memory space in the NVRAM, and contact Technical Support if that does not free enough space.
Does F01690 trigger a safety stop?
No. The manual states that this fault does not result in a safety stop response.
Why can I not acknowledge F01690 in operation?
The fault requires a POWER ON acknowledgement, so the drive only clears it when the power supply has been switched off and on again.
